Understanding Assigned Agents
A official agent is an person or business appointed to receive important legal papers on behalf of a corporation or LLC. This includes documents such as tax alerts, summons, and other official communications from the state. Having a reliable registered agent is crucial for making sure that your enterprise remains in compliance with local regulations and deadlines.
Company owners can choose to function as their self-appointed registered agent or employ a registered agent service. A lot of entrepreneurs commonly select to retain qualified registered agents to preserve privacy and ensure that judicial responsibilities are met without disruption. This is particularly beneficial for those who may not have a physical presence in the area where their company is established.
The duties of a registered agent extend past just receiving papers. They must also ensure that the company remains in accordance with legal registered agent conditions, such as prompt filing of yearly reports and updating updated information with government entities. By understanding the role and importance of a registered agent, founders can make knowledgeable decisions that support the long-term prosperity of their business.

Compliance Matters and Legal Compliance
When creating a business structure, understanding the lawful necessities and regulatory responsibilities regarding your registered agent is crucial. A designated agent must have a tangible address in the state of incorporation, serving as the official point of contact for law-related and tax-related papers. This guarantees that any essential notices, such as legal summons or formal notifications, can be delivered efficiently and effectively. For LLCs and corporations, appointing a qualified registered agent is not only a statutory obligation but also essential for maintaining a proper status with state authorities.
Adhering to regulations also involves confirming that the registered agent is present during standard operating hours to accept legal documents. The inability to have a registered agent comply with these legal requirements can lead to overlooked legal communications, which may result in consequences or involuntary judgments against your enterprise. Hence, hiring a dependable registered agent service is essential, as they can ensure that these responsibilities are met reliably and accurately, ensuring your company remains aligned with jurisdictional statutes.
Additionally, different states may have different statutory requirements concerning designated agents. It is crucial to get to know with these details, as regulatory problems can arise over time. For example, some states may require a registered agent to be a state resident or even a qualified expert. To manage these challenges and avoid possible legal troubles, many entrepreneurs choose to hire a dedicated registered agent service that concentrates in legal adherence, thereby guaranteeing that they meet all required duties and maintain their enterprise's proper status.
